Norway’s wealth fund vote is latest blow to Musk’s $1 trillion pay package

TechCrunchTuesday, November 4, 2025 at 6:24:51 PM
Elon Musk's ambitious $1 trillion performance pay package faces another setback as Norway's wealth fund votes against it. This decision highlights ongoing challenges Musk encounters in securing support from major shareholders.

Control of Tesla Is at Stake in Vote on Elon Musk’s Pay Plan
NeutralArtificial Intelligence
The upcoming vote on Elon Musk's pay plan is crucial for Tesla's future, as it could determine his level of influence within the company. Supporters argue that the proposed trillion-dollar package is necessary to keep Musk engaged, while critics believe it grants him excessive power. This debate highlights the ongoing tension between Musk and investors, making it a pivotal moment for Tesla's governance and direction.
